What most sales administrators actually earn

Half of sales administrators earn between £22,764 and £32,336. Earning above £32,336 puts you in the top quarter of the profession.

Sales Administrator salary by region

10 of 11 GB regions have a published figure for this occupation.

Region Median Mean
London £34,242 £33,604
Yorkshire and The Humber £29,911 £28,653
Wales £27,807 £27,955
North West £27,579 £26,904
South East £26,857 £26,632
Scotland £26,439 £25,992
South West £25,853 £25,945
East Midlands £25,214 £25,655
West Midlands £25,165 £24,848
East £24,491 £24,987

Sales Administrator salary FAQs

What is the average Sales Administrator salary in UK?

The median is £27,132 a year and the mean is £26,905, according to the ONS Annual Survey of Hours and Earnings. Those cover all employees; full-time employees alone have a median of £28,745 and part-time employees £13,574.

What is a good Sales Administrator salary?

Half of sales administrators earn between £22,764 and £32,336. Anything above £32,336 is in the top quarter for the role.

Is this figure official?

Yes. It comes from the ONS Annual Survey of Hours and Earnings, an accredited official statistic based on employer PAYE records, covering 49,000 jobs in this occupation.
